A port side stern view of the US Navy (USN) The Military Sealift Command (MSC) Mercy Class: Hospital Ship USNS COMFORT (T-AH 20), being assisted by the commercial tugboat Natalie Colle, while conducting mooring operations at the Port of Pascagoula, Mississippi (MS). The ship will provide medical assistance to the victims of Hurricane Katrina in the region. The USN is currently involved in Hurricane Katrina humanitarian assistance operations, led by the Federal Emergency Management Agency (FEMA), in conjunction with the Department of Defense (DOD)
